Grapes: 60% Merlot, 30% Cabernet Franc and 10% Sangiovese. Stored for up to 10 years. Decanting open 1 hour before serving. Tasting note: Intense fruit flavors of ripe red berries and plums, combined with delicious notes of sweet spices, vanilla and Mediterranean herbs. On the palate it shows a lot of finesse, as they show great French wines. The structure and strong texture seduce with a lot of enamel and boasts a modern lightness. A wine of the very great pleasure to! General: The Vineyard Aia Vecchia is run by the Pellegrini family in Bibbona in Bolgheri. The Lagon aged 12 months in barriques, then it is left for 6 months in bottle. The respected winemaker Tibor Gál managed to unite with this assemblage, the Italian terroir with the finesse of a great Frenchman. To eat: He fits very well with hearty meat dishes, grilled dishes, lamb, pasta dishes and rich cheese assortment. Delivery unit: 0.75 LT.
